The Core Concept: Random Connections and Global Reach

Synoomy’s fundamental premise revolves around connecting users through randomly distributed posts.

Unlike traditional social media where you follow specific people or groups, Synoomy throws your content out to a diverse, often global, audience.

This “randomness” is a defining characteristic, aiming to foster serendipitous interactions and introduce you to individuals you might otherwise never encounter.

It’s a bit like throwing a message in a bottle, but with a digital twist and the hope of an immediate reply.

How Random Posts Drive Interaction

The mechanism is straightforward: you create a post – be it text, a photo, or a voice message – and Synoomy sends it to a set number of random users. For free accounts, this is up to 20 recipients, while premium users can reach 40 recipients. This initial broadcast acts as a conversation starter. If a recipient finds your post interesting, they can initiate a chat. Filtering Options: Adding a Layer of Control

While the core is “random,” Synoomy does provide filters to refine your audience. You can specify recipients by gender, age range, or country. This offers a degree of control, allowing users to tailor their interactions to specific demographics or geographic locations if desired. For instance, if you’re looking to practice a new language, you could filter by a specific country. However, it’s important to remember that even with filters, the specific individuals receiving your post are still randomly selected within those parameters.

Creating and Managing Posts

The process of creating a post seems intuitive.

You select the content type text, image, or voice, compose your message or upload your media, and then send it out.

Managing these posts is also outlined: once all recipients have either responded or skipped your post, it’s automatically archived.

Users can also manually archive posts after a day, which prevents further conversations from being initiated via that specific post.

Standard Free Features

The free account provides a solid foundation for experiencing Synoomy’s core functionalities.

You can send and receive posts, chat with people, and make friends. Battlesnake.com Reviews

The main limitations are the number of recipients per post, daily message limits, and the presence of ads.

For casual users or those wanting to test the waters, the free tier offers a good starting point.

Addressing Inactivity: Staying Active on Synoomy

One interesting point raised in the FAQ is the concept of “inactive” accounts and how it affects post reception.

Synoomy prioritizes active users when distributing posts.

If a user doesn’t take action on received posts for a while e.g., skipping or starting a chat, their account might be marked as inactive.

This is a mechanism to ensure that posts reach engaged users, maximizing the chances of interaction. Outlinx.com Reviews

How Inactivity Affects Post Reception

If your account is marked as inactive, you may receive fewer posts.

This is a clever way for the platform to optimize its random distribution algorithm, ensuring that posts are sent to users who are more likely to engage.

It encourages consistent participation rather than passive presence.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is Synoomy.com?

Synoomy.com is a social networking platform that connects users globally through random posts, enabling them to chat and make new friends based on shared content.

How does Synoomy work?

Users create posts text, picture, or voice which are sent to a random selection of other users.

Recipients can then choose to start a chat with the post sender, leading to potential friendships.

What types of content can I share on Synoomy posts?

You can share text, pictures, and voice messages in your Synoomy posts.

You can include one or more content types in a single post. Beecut.com Reviews

How many people receive my posts on Synoomy?

For free accounts, a post can be sent to a maximum of 20 recipients.

Premium users can have their posts sent to up to 40 recipients.

Can I filter who receives my posts on Synoomy?

Yes, you can filter recipients by gender, age range, or country, even though the specific individuals within those filters are still randomly selected.

What happens if I don’t respond to received posts on Synoomy?

If you don’t take action on received posts for a while skip or start a chat, your account may be marked as inactive, which can reduce the number of posts you receive.

How do I re-activate my Synoomy account if it’s marked as inactive?

You can re-activate your account by simply skipping a received post or starting a new conversation via a post you’ve received.

How do I start a chat with someone on Synoomy?

If you receive a post you like, you can tap to start a chat with the sender.

How do I send a friend request on Synoomy?

To send a friend request, you must first have an active conversation with the user.

If you’re already chatting, you can tap the add friend icon on the conversation screen.

How can I manage my friend requests on Synoomy?

You can view and manage friend requests in the top section of the chat interface.

This section only appears if you have pending friend requests.

What is the difference between a free and a premium Synoomy account?

A free account has limitations on recipients per post 20, daily image/text messages, and includes ads.

A premium account $3.99/month offers 40 recipients per post, significantly higher daily message limits, and is ad-free.

Is there a free trial for Synoomy Premium?

Yes, Synoomy offers a 15-day free trial for its premium subscription. It has no commitment, and you can cancel anytime.

Will I be charged after my Synoomy Premium trial if I cancel?

No, you will not be charged if you cancel your trial before it expires.

You can continue to use the trial subscription until its expiration date.

What happens if I cancel my Synoomy Premium subscription?

If you cancel your premium subscription, you will still have access to the premium features for the remainder of the period you have already paid for.

You will not be charged for subsequent billing cycles.

How are Synoomy subscriptions managed?

Synoomy premium subscriptions fully comply with Google Play Subscription rules and are managed through your Google Play account.

Can I restore a cancelled or expired Synoomy Premium subscription?

If your subscription is still active, you can restore it via Google Play.

If it has expired, you will need to purchase a new subscription.

What are “archived posts” on Synoomy?

Posts are automatically archived once all recipients have either responded or skipped them.

You can also manually archive a post at least one day after creation.

Once archived, pending recipients cannot start conversations via that post.

Why might my Synoomy account be blocked?

Your account may be permanently blocked if you violate Synoomy’s Terms of Use.

How can I end a friendship on Synoomy?

Go to your profile section, tap “friends,” then hold down on the user you wish to unfriend, and tap “End Friendship” to confirm the action.
